Ultimate Philly Cheesesteak Meatloaf
Satisfy your Philly cheesesteak cravings with this juicy, cheesy Philly Cheesesteak Meatloaf! Packed with tender ground beef, sautéed onions, bell peppers, and melty provolone, this twist on the classic meatloaf is pure comfort food. Perfect for a weeknight dinner, meal prep, or game day feast!
Ingredients:
For the Meatloaf:
1 lb ground beef
1 small onion, finely chopped
1 green bell pepper, finely chopped
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 cup breadcrumbs
½ cup milk
¼ cup ketchup
1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
1 tsp salt
½ tsp black pepper
½ tsp dried oregano
½ tsp dried thyme
½ tsp dried basil
½ tsp paprika
For the Cheesesteak Filling:
1 cup sliced mushrooms
1 cup provolone or American cheese (or Cheese Whiz for classic Philly flavor)
Instructions:
Preheat & Prep: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
Mix the Meatloaf Base: In a large bowl, combine ground beef, onion, bell pepper, garlic, breadcrumbs, and milk. Stir well.
Season It Up: Add 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, salt, black pepper, oregano, thyme, basil, and paprika. Mix until fully combined.
Flatten & Fill: On a piece of wax paper or foil, flatten the meat mixture into a ½-inch thick rectangle.
Layer the Cheesesteak Goodness: Spread mushrooms and cheese over the meat, leaving a 1-inch border around the edges.
Roll & Seal: Carefully roll the meatloaf into a log, sealing the edges to lock in the cheesy filling.
Bake to Perfection: Place the rolled meatloaf seam-side down in a baking dish. Bake for 45-55 minutes, or until the internal temp reaches 160°F (71°C).
Rest & Serve: Let it rest for a few minutes before slicing. Enjoy with sautéed onions, peppers, or a side of crispy fries!
